Papers of Lyn Newman
| Title |
ALS to Hella Weyl written on the SS Nyassa |
| Reference |
Weyl/58 |
| Creator |
Lyn Newman |
| Covering Dates |
18 Sep. 1943 (Circa.) |
| Extent and Medium |
2 p; paper |
|
| Content and context |
Explains that they are travelling back to England via Portugal and without Max's consent as he did not reply to her cable. Hopes that Hermann can keep Fanny Kemble's letters for her. Describes her voyage. Asks Hella to write to her c/o Max at St John's College. |
